[Progressive Records” released many masterpieces such as “George Warrington at Cafe Bohemia” in the 1950’s, and after its reemergence in the 1970’s, released many works by famous pianists such as Mal Waldron and Tommy Flanagan. Progressive Records” has released many masterpieces by famous pianists such as Mal Waldron and Tommy Flanagan, and “Famous Door”, a label of former Keynote producer Harry Lim, now on the same parent label, has released a 1970s jazz master collection! The third phase of 20 titles ◇A swingy piano trio album by Derek Smith’s trio, who was almost unknown in Japan! The technical Smith’s piano swings with the great groove of George Mraz (b) and Billy Hart (ds)! World’s first CD release. Remastered for the first time in the world, with Japanese commentary. (Recorded in 1978)
